Crawlspace waterproofing services focus on preventing water intrusion and moisture buildup beneath a building’s foundation. These services typically involve installing barriers such as vapor barriers or sealants to block ground moisture from seeping into the space. Additionally, contractors may implement drainage systems, sump pumps, and dehumidifiers to manage and remove excess water, creating a more controlled environment. Proper waterproofing helps protect the structural integrity of the property by reducing the risk of water-related damage over time.
Addressing common problems such as persistent dampness, mold growth, and wood rot is a primary benefit of crawlspace waterproofing. Excess moisture in the crawlspace can lead to musty odors and deterioration of wooden beams and flooring above. Waterproofing services help mitigate these issues by controlling humidity levels and preventing water from accumulating. This not only preserves the condition of the property’s foundation but also contributes to healthier indoor air quality by reducing mold and mildew development.

Cost Range - Crawlspace waterproofing services typically cost between $1,500 and $4,000 for standard installations. Factors such as the size of the area and specific waterproofing methods can influence the final price. Example projects in Bowie, MD, often fall within this range.
Material Expenses - The price of materials like vapor barriers, sump pumps, and drainage systems can vary from $500 to $2,500. Higher-quality or specialized materials tend to increase overall costs for waterproofing projects.
Labor Costs - Labor charges for crawlspace waterproofing usually range from $1,000 to $3,000, depending on the complexity of the work. Local contractors may offer different rates based on project size and accessibility.
Additional Charges - Extra costs may include excavation, repairs, or addressing existing issues, which can add $500 to $2,000 to the total. These costs vary based on the condition of the crawlspace and specific site requirements.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is crawlspace waterproofing? Crawlspace waterproofing involves methods to prevent water intrusion and moisture buildup in the crawlspace area, helping to protect the home’s foundation and indoor air quality.
How can waterproofing improve my home's safety? Proper waterproofing can reduce the risk of mold growth, wood rot, and structural damage caused by excess moisture in the crawlspace.
What signs indicate a need for crawlspace waterproofing? Signs include persistent dampness, musty odors, mold growth, or visible water pooling in the crawlspace area.
Are there different waterproofing options available? Yes, options may include interior drainage systems, vapor barriers, sump pumps, and exterior waterproofing measures, depending on the situation.
